Zcash Surges Above $1,200 as Privacy Coin Market Cap Crosses $20 Billion

Zcash has suddenly become one of the most closely watched altcoins in the cryptocurrency market.

The privacy-focused cryptocurrency rose to approximately $1,249.28 before pulling back toward $1,195, reaching its highest price since 2016. Cointelegraph reported that ZEC had gained approximately 45% over the previous week and 138% over the previous 30 days.

The move pushed Zcash’s market capitalization above $20 billion.

The rally is particularly notable because privacy coins have spent years facing regulatory uncertainty and questions about mainstream adoption.

Why Is Zcash Moving?

One major catalyst has been renewed institutional interest.

Grayscale’s Zcash ETF began trading on NYSE Arca on August 25.

Cointelegraph reported that the fund had approximately $463.2 million in assets under management at the time of its report.

The development gives investors a regulated market vehicle for gaining exposure to Zcash.

That changes the potential investor base for the asset.

Instead of relying entirely on cryptocurrency exchanges, investors can access exposure through an exchange-traded product.

What Is Zcash?

Zcash is a cryptocurrency focused on privacy.

It was designed to provide users with the ability to transact while protecting certain transaction information through zero-knowledge cryptography.

Unlike Bitcoin, where transaction details are publicly visible on the blockchain, Zcash supports privacy-enhanced transactions.

That feature has always been central to its identity.

But it has also created regulatory challenges.

Why Privacy Coins Have Struggled

Privacy technology creates a conflict.

Users value financial privacy.

Regulators often want transaction transparency to combat:

  • money laundering
  • sanctions evasion
  • fraud
  • illicit financing

As governments strengthen cryptocurrency compliance requirements, privacy-focused assets can face additional pressure.

Some exchanges have historically restricted or removed privacy coins because of those concerns.
